OK.. I don't know how it is IRL...  but the Captain Sim 757 allows for pilot fuel management.

You can manipulate how much each tank is used by pump selection (two per tank, including center).. and if there is fuel in only one set of wing tanks.. the only way for both engines to run is if croos-feed is turned on..
